Dad Said “Girls Don’t Run Businesses,” Left Everything to My Brother—A Year Later, I Was CEO
The weight of my father's leather-bound notebook felt heavier than it should have as I placed it on my sleek mahogany desk. Outside my corner office, the Manhattan skyline glittered like a constellation of ambition. Just eighteen months earlier, I'd stood in the rain watching my father's company—my birthright—being handed to my brother on a silver platter. "The business world is no place for a woman," Dad had said the day before he died, his final words to me cutting deeper than any knife. Now, as acting CEO of Reynolds Enterprises, I straightened the photograph of him on my desk—the same one who'd once told me I'd never have what it takes. The board meeting to formalize my position was in an hour. They had no idea I'd been running the company from the shadows all along, saving it from the brink of collapse while my brother took all the credit. Today, everything would change.
